Descrição
Resumo:Spotify® uses data mining and profiling to provide a personalized experience for its users. This study analyzes Spotify® patent applications related to algorithmic user experience personalization. Using Questel Orbit Intelligence®, 18 patent applications were identified, grouped into three categories. The first addresses technical criteria for recommendations, the second focuses on users' subjective preferences, while the third presents distinct characteristics. These requests reflect Spotify®'s efforts to provide a personalized experience, including suggesting content through algorithmic means. Some requests suggest personalizing ads based on predictions of users' mood and location. This analysis confirms the presence of algorithmic personalization on the platform and highlights concerns about the serving of advertisements, in addition to the ethical limits of the use of artificial intelligence, indicating the need for regulation to mitigate possible risks to consumers or the creative industry.
